Breaking Through Barriers: Firsts in Space

Imagine looking down at Earth from above, seeing the blue oceans and green landmasses spread out below. That’s what Valentina Tereshkova saw on June 16, 1963, when she became the first woman to travel into space! This incredible feat opened doors for women in science and engineering, inspiring many to follow in her footsteps. Valentina’s journey in the Vostok 6 spacecraft showed the world that there were no limits to what women could achieve.
The Wheel: A First that Changed Everything

It might seem like a simple invention, but the wheel was truly revolutionary! Around 3500 BC, someone had the brilliant idea of using a round object to move heavy things. Before the wheel, people had to drag or carry things, which was slow and difficult. The wheel made transportation easier and faster, allowing people to trade goods, explore new places, and build societies more effectively. Think about how much we rely on wheels today – from cars to bicycles to rollerblades, the wheel continues to shape our lives!
Firsts in the World of Medicine

Before the 18th century, diseases like smallpox could wipe out entire communities. People were terrified of getting sick! But in 1796, Edward Jenner made a remarkable discovery. He found that a substance from cowpox, a less severe disease, could protect people from smallpox. Jenner’s discovery led to the development of vaccines, which have saved countless lives and helped control the spread of many dangerous diseases. Thanks to his groundbreaking work, we live in a world where we have the chance to be protected from terrible illnesses.
Making History: Firsts in Technology

Have you ever wondered how computers work? Well, a long time ago, a brilliant inventor named Charles Babbage had a similar question. In the 1800s, he dreamed of creating a machine that could perform complex calculations. Although he didn’t complete his “Analytical Engine,” his ideas inspired future generations to create the computers we use today. From smartphones to gaming consoles to the internet, Babbage’s work laid the foundation for a technological revolution that continues to transform our world.
